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
137 967769 7947695 945855
11502 9855521
11502 9855521
198618 42515 5782
All about undefined
Interested in learning more?
11502 9855521
198618 42515 5782
See more
0608 632189
334176 17 349
See more
7981748935 86395093856 597
63401741601 84388 0976615
See more